Young hero Bellamkonda Sai Srinivas will be seen in the role of an immigrant turned mafia don in the Hindi remake of Prabhas-Rajamouli’s blockbuster 2005 action drama, Chatrapati. This VV Vinayak directorial will be going on floors in Hyderabad from the 12th of July.
Interestingly, Sai himself will be dubbing for his role in his maiden Bollywood film. The actor has been taking Hindi classes for the last few months, and a tutor has been flown in from Mumbai to Hyderabad to teach the nuances of the language to the young hero. Sai is determined to make a solid impact in Bollywood on his first attempt, and it looks like he is not leaving any stone unturned.
